QR code equipment inspection how to apply?

Equipment inspection is the normalized work of many enterprises, the purpose is to grasp the operating conditions of the equipment and changes in the surrounding environment, timely detection of hidden equipment and potential risks, and then reduce the occurrence of failures, keep the equipment in a good state of operation, to protect the safety of the equipment and system stability.

The current equipment inspection is generally three aspects of the problem:

1, inspection is not in place, missed, or not allowed to time;

2, manually fill in the inspection results of low efficiency, easy to miss or error;

3, managers are difficult to timely, accurate and comprehensive understanding of the inspection status, the development of the corresponding maintenance and repair programs.
